Abstract

If you are wondering what Groove is, you are not alone. Groove gets the award as the newest and least known addition to the Microsoft Office Suite. Groove provides you with a personal collaboration area where you can bring together small teams from within or even outside your company. You can even invite friends and neighbors into your collaboration site. Within your site, you can

  • Share documents

  • Create calendars

  • Participate in discussions

  • Publish forms

  • Track issues

  • Hold meetings

  • Share pictures

  • And more
